Onuachu Hails Trabzonspor’s Hard-Earned Victory Over Galatasaray

Onuachu Hails Trabzonspor’s Hard-Earned Victory Over Galatasaray

Paul Onuachu has praised Trabzonspor’s 2-1 win over Galatasaray at Papara Park. He and teammate Chibuike Nwaiwu scored the goals that stunned the title holders. Onuachu said the team gave their all in front of their fans and earned their reward. “We respect Galatasaray—they have very good players,” he added. The 31-year-old striker insists Trabzonspor will keep fighting for the title. “We’ll take it one match at a time, win every game and see what happens,” Onuachu said after the game.
